—>heisekaidangku

:) Hello !

• Waiting for that useful addition, you could get a clue about the watermark handling,
since it's already available from the “Paint” tool : Filter Menu >> Paint in 1.90.3.
- You could get an info from THIS TOPIC online (might be added to the official Help too…).
- However, just as a “training”, because indeed the batch handling is not supported from the “Paint” tool…
- For such tries, please use copies !

• Like helmut says above, all image-formats supported at writing can be used,
as well for the main image, as for the watermarked background…
- Some features are missing still, i.e. to tile from a small image…
